Camelot at Federal Hill is a charming event venue nestled in the heart of Perth Amboy, NJ.
Offering a picturesque setting for various gatherings and celebrations, Camelot at Federal Hill provides a unique and elegant space for guests to create lasting memories.
Generated from their business information